  1. Smith has crafted an album that is deft, addictive and profoundly musical, and it feels like a fresh-minted classic.
  2. New Musical Express (NME)
    90
    A set of immense maturity that never rubs your nose in its thematic complexity, compositional innovation and thunderous thump-beats. [29 Jan 2005, p.58]
  3. Awfully Deep is another strong release for Smith, and while it doesn’t sport the effortless flow of his debut or the rich variety of Run Come Save Me, its considered assessment of where he’s been and where he might be heading helps the album more than live up to its title.
  4. Smith’s tracks are both banging and self-effacing, yet the two opposite impulses never seem fully at odds with each other.
  5. Uncut
    80
    THe good stuff is terrific. [Mar 2005, p.104]
  6. Awfully Deep, on the whole, is a bold, ambitious swing for the fences. But, like it or not, the game's done changed, and Manuva '05 sounds way too much like Manuva '01.
  7. Spin
    58
    His third album mostly shelves the wit and sui generis style-clash. [Jun 2005, p.108]
